Abstract In this article, asphaltene index, aging index, and Gastel index (Ic) are introduced to study the aging resistance of paving asphalts. Meanwhile, the solubility parameter theory is applied to evaluate the aging resistance of these paving asphalts. The results show that the greater the asphaltene index, the aging index or the Gastel index, the worse the aging resistance of the paving asphalt. The small difference between solubility parameters of asphaltene and maltene of the paving asphalt contributes to its good aging resistance. The analytical results in these two ways are consistent.
